The sizes are way over. Go to Academy sports and buy a beaded jump rope first. Cut it to the size that works for you, then order one from Crossrope. This will save you $100s of dollars. They size you way too big.
I've ordered their recommended size...too big, then I ordered the next size down, still too big, finally got it after the 3rd try.
You can not alter the size yourself unless you can tig weld or you know someone that does. If you wait too long to return a rope that is too big...you are out of luck.

I bought set of ropeless 1/4 and 1/2 pound “ropes” to workout inside (my ceilings are too low to workout with my regular ropes indoors). They work really well and I feel I’m getting a good workout. However, I don’t necessary feel I’m getting the same workout as with the equivalent rope, especially with the 1/4 pound. I notice that since there is no rope hitting the ground with each jump, there is less resistance. Not only does this make the “rope” feel lighter, but it also allows the rope to speed up and get away from your tempo quite easily. I’m basically just using the 1/2 pound set because the 1/4 pound is too light and just spins out of control. If I had to do it again, I would probably just get 1/2 and 3/4 to feel like my 1/4 and 1/2 pound ropes.
